What to major in if you want to work in a lab?

Becoming a medical laboratory scientist requires earning a bachelor’s degree in clinical laboratory science or a related field, such as biology or chemistry. Since medical laboratory scientists perform a wider scope of responsibilities, they need more education and training to fulfill their role than technicians.

Can you work in a laboratory with a biology degree?

Medical and clinical laboratory technologists typically have a bachelor’s degree in biology or medical technology. Their job entails collecting samples and performing laboratory tests to analyze such bodily fluids as urine, blood and tissue.

What degree is best for lab technician?

Lab technicians need at minimum a high school diploma or equivalent to work. Most companies prefer at least an Associate’s Degree in Laboratory Science or related major. It can be helpful to earn a degree from an institution accredited by the National Accrediting Agency for Clinical Laboratory Sciences.

What do biological technicians do?

Biological technicians typically do the following: Set up, maintain, and clean laboratory instruments and equipment, such as microscopes, scales, pipets, and test tubes. Gather and prepare biological samples, such as blood, food, and bacteria cultures, for laboratory analysis. Conduct biological tests and experiments.

What is the difference between a lab technician and a lab technologist?

Technologists are often supervisors in charge of training technicians in the lab. Technologists primarily work behind the scenes in the lab performing testing; technicians are considered the public face of the lab and have direct contact with patients.

What is lab technician salary?

Clinical Laboratory Technicians made a median salary of $54,180 in 2020. The best-paid 25 percent made $69,650 that year, while the lowest-paid 25 percent made $39,680.

How do I become a biological technologist?

What training is required? Completion of a two- to three-year college program in a field related to agriculture, biology, microbiology, wildlife or resource management is usually required for employment as a biological technologist.

How do you become a biomedical technician?

To become a biomedical technician, you will need at least a two-year associate degree in biomedical equipment technology, engineering technology or a related field. These hands-on programs give you the skills and knowledge to install and maintain medical equipment on the job.

Is a BA or BS in biology better?

In general, a BS degree provides a more science-focused education, while a BA degree includes language and humanities courses. The type of major you choose should depend on your ultimate career goals. If you plan to pursue advanced study in biology or medicine, a BS degree might be the best choice.

Can a biology degree lead to medical school?

These courses typically include biology, chemistry, physics, math, statistics, and English. This means that a student of any major can apply to medical school as long as these required courses are completed. In other words, whether you major in biology, math, economics, history, or art, you can apply to medical school.
